A RITUAL OF OUR OWN TO BOND

-

When my twins were about four years old we started our bedtime prayers routine together every night before my husband and I tucked them in.

We then had a special ritual where I would say to them: “I love you my Nunu.”

They would reply: “Love you more my Nunuza.’’ Then we all say, “Sleep tight, don’t let the bedbugs bite,’’ and kiss each other goodnight.

This worked so well that even when away on sleepovers they would call us before they slept just to say, “Love you more my Nunuza.”

Recently my husband and I were blessed with a beautiful baby girl and though she is still a baby we plan on including her in our bedtime ritual. We all go to bed every night saying the same things to each other. It’s incredibly heartwarmi­ng.

Hopefully, one day when they have kids of their own they’ll be able to do the same with them.
